UNIVERSEH is an alliance of seven young and mature universities, from seven European countries: 🇫🇷 France: Université de Toulouse 🇵🇱 Poland: AGH University of Technology 🇱🇺 Luxembourg: Université du Luxembourg 🇸🇪 Sweden: Luleå University of Technology 🇩🇪 Germany: Heinrich Heine Universität Düsseldorf 🇮🇹 Italia : Università degli Studi di Roma Tor Vergata 🇧🇪 Belgium : Université de Namur These universities were selected to conduct a new way of collaboration in a unique field, Space, within the new “European Universities” initiative promoted by the European Commission. 🌍 Balancing Exploration and Impact: Key discussions in Toulouse ➡️ On May 27, and in line with our commitment to sustainable space activities, UNIVERSEH European University and UNIVERSEH Students Toulouse co-organized this exchange with Pour un réveil écologique in ISAE-SUPAERO. 🛰️ Space activities offer numerous benefits, from Earth observation for climate change understanding to researching the origins of the universe and providing global positioning systems. However, some applications, such as space tourism and mega-constellations, have limited societal value. 🌠 It is crucial to evaluate the societal utility of each space project against its impacts, especially as the sector grows and liberalizes. The January 2024 report by Pour un réveil écologique (PRÉ) provides the first public synthesis of these issues, targeting students and young graduates who are eager to align their career choices with their values. This report highlights the current state and impacts of the space sector, urging a reevaluation of its contributions to society. In line with our commitment to sustainable space activities, UNIVERSEH European University and UNIVERSEH Students Toulouse co-organized this exchange with the PRÉ collective. 🥼 The report presentation was followed by discussions with industry experts, focusing on actions to mitigate the space sector's impact and addressing remaining uncertainties. 🔸 Marlène de BANK, Research Engineer at The Shift Project, President of AÉRO DÉCARBO; 🔸 Alexandre Tisserant, CEO of Kinéis; 🔸 Stéphanie Lizy-Destrez, Lecturer at ISAE-SUPAERO; 🔸 Sophie Vilarem, Environmental Expert at CNES. 🔹 The roundtable was moderated by Prunelle Vogler and Julien Doche, co-authors of the Pour un réveil écologique space report. #UNIVERSEH #SpaceSector #SustainableSpace

Workshop – Technical Standardization in Space and Sustainability 📢 On the one hand, some of space activities are considered as means to efficiently address climate change (notably with Earth observation tools), but on the other hand, they can also be considered as a source of pollution for terrestrial and space environments, caused by space debris, for instance. Moreover, currently space is opening its doors to an increasing number of private entities, generating the need for a common understanding and good practices to enable safe and harmonized operations, especially when these could yield an impact on the environment and on the feasibility of space activities. 🚀 Space Industry Experts at the Akademia Górniczo-Hutnicza w Krakowie ! On May 23-24, 2024, the Centrum Technologii Kosmicznych AGH - Space Technology Centre at AGH University hosted the prestigious Space Resources Conference. It was already the seventh edition and his cosmic event continues to grow in significance every year. During the two-day conference, we had the privilege of hearing from space experts, including: Prof. Kazuya Yoshida (Tohoku University), Prof. Tanja Masson-Zwaan (Vice President of the International Astronautical Federation), Prof. Nicolas Peter (President of the International Space University ISU), Prof. Larry Martinez (California State University), Dr. Danijela Ignjatović Ogrizović (International Space University ISU), Dr. Virginia Wotring (International Space University ISU), Prof. Enrico Stoll (Technische Universität Berlin). Over 100 participants presented their research through oral and poster presentations, with many contributions from UNIVERSEH students. Topics covered included the Artemis lunar program, space law, space technologies, space medicine, robotics, and sustainability in space.
